Fix overlay creation logic to use reg value for node names
This commit fixes device tree overlay creation logic and templates
to use reg values for node names.
Change-Id: I0945ad204c74a52a96ac283884a699e125b703fe
Signed-off-by: Jae Hyun Yoo <jae.hyun.yoo@intel.com>
diff --git a/overlay_templates/PCA9543Mux.template b/overlay_templates/PCA9543Mux.template
index 49257c4..d85a6c3 100644
--- a/overlay_templates/PCA9543Mux.template
+++ b/overlay_templates/PCA9543Mux.template
@@ -6,9 +6,9 @@
target = <&i2c$bus>;
__overlay__{
status = "okay";
- smbus_mux@$Name {
+ $Name: smbus_mux@$address {
compatible = "nxp,pca9543";
- reg = <$address>;
+ reg = <0x$address>;
#address-cells = <1>;
#size-cells = <0>;
oemname1 = "$Name";